India-U.K. CETA and DCC: Goyal’s June 2026 visit to review rollout readiness
Commerce Minister Piyush Goyal will visit the U.K. on 25-27 June 2026 to review implementation readiness for the India-U.K. CETA and DCC due on 15 July.

In June 2026, Commerce Minister Piyush Goyal is scheduled to visit the United Kingdom from 25-27 June to review readiness for the India-U.K. Comprehensive Economic and Trade Agreement (CETA) and the Double Contribution Convention (DCC), both set for implementation on 15 July 2026.
Key specifics
- The visit dates are 25-27 June 2026.
- The implementation date mentioned for CETA and DCC is 15 July 2026.
- Peter Kyle is the U.K. Secretary of State for Business and Trade.
- The talks will cover regulatory roadmaps and cross-border customs coordination.
- The agreements include tariff liberalisation commitments and mutual market access in key services sectors.
